Our CEO and co-founder Thuc Vu is on the road to bring Ohmnilabs' latest product, Kambria, our decentralized AI and Robotics platform to Asia, starting with Singapore, Japan, Korea, and Vietnam.
Thuc unveiled Kambria at the Ethereum Singapore Meetup held at the Paypal Innovation Lab in Singapore, in front of around 70 attendees this week.
The Ethereum Singapore Meetup is a group committed to promoting Ethereum, a decentralized blockchain powered computing platform. Ethereum Singapore Meetup is currently the largest of its kind in Asia with 3,356 members as we speak and is sponsored by DigixGlobal, the first smart asset Company built on Ethereum.
